Resume Tracker.
It's good habit to track where your resume is going. If you've never thought to do so before, there are a host of reasons to consider it for the future. If you're working with recruiting companies they often can present you as a candidate for positions at companies you've already applied. If you're unemployed and receiving benefits you are required by law to report on where you have applied. Even if you've kept track previously you know what a hassle it can be managing the process with your e-mail client or with a spreadsheet.
